Pedestrianisation and car-free zones: Ljubljana, Slovenia – EBRD
Moreover, Ljubljana implemented several supporting policies, such as the establishment of five new park and-ride facilities, the purchase of 32 new CNG buses and the introduction of an electric tourist train.
